RoofRats on RoofRats's wall - 14 October 2020 - 3:05 pm
I am just noticing this, I have built a Honey ESB and was getting ready for my brew day when I noticed that Honey is considered a fermentable grain???? Not sure why honey is considered a fermentable grain. But in all the honey added to the boil and secondary only not the mash an extra 2 lbs of grain that should not have been included in the mash from the honey. Can anybody help with how I can keep non grain fermentable out of the grain bill?? Because of this I ended up doing the math to get my strike water correct for grain only. Any help would be appreciated.
